Focus: Psalms 25:4-5 - KJV

4. Shew me thy ways, O LORD; teach me thy paths. 5. Lead me in thy truth, and teach me: for thou art the God of my salvation; on thee do I wait all the day.

 

Psalms 25:1-7

 

No one knows the way of the Lord like the Lord Himself. Human teachers are never a hundred percent accurate and therefore, they are not able to teach the way of the Lord excellently as the Lord Himself would. Most that claim to be mentors do not themselves know as much as some whom they seek to mentor because they are equally not fully baked. Half knowledge amounts to illiteracy in right quarters and should be discouraged. Hence, the best teacher anyone can have is the Lord Himself, when it comes to His ways.

 

Saul of Tarsus assumed he knew the Lord until he encountered the Master directly. From then on, his hunger and thirst for the knowledge of God became insatiable. He started with a human mentor called Ananias who did not understand God enough to know that when He speaks, He is not to be challenged or queried. Before we knew it, he did not amount to much when put beside Paul. This fellow (Paul) then enrolled in the school of the Holy Spirit until he got to the level of differentiating between what he wrote based on the voice of the Spirit and based on his own reasoning which, when considered, could not have been far from the position of the Holy Spirit.

 

The Lord wants us to know that human mentors are good as He is the one that ordained some of them to teach. But, as we do not know those, He so ordained and since none is perfectly in tune, it is better we all enroll in the School of the Holy Ghost to discover the Lord’s way from the source. Like the Father gave us Christ to listen to, Christ handed us over to the Holy Spirit to teach us all things. Let us therefore, be passionate to learn all things from Him that knows the father and the Son and equally knows God’s ways.
